Bloo v 0.13 released

Bloo v 0.13 has been released. Below is a summary of the new features:

  • I’ve implemented an RSS 2.0 feed (see the right sidebar). The feed has validated, but please let me know if it ever goes invalid in your reader. I basically wrote it from scratch.
  • Now the posts have a day header on them
  • I am now pinging to rpc.pingomatic.com, rather than to weblogs.com. Hopefully this will provide for a more reliable ping when this blog updates
  • Now when creating a post I can create a “Draft” that only I can see. This will come in handy for me as I’m a major re-writer/editor of my posts. They usually change about 7 times after I publish them to the blog – now you won’t have to “watch me for the changes” as my posts morph before your eyes.
  • There is now a Search “snapon” – see the right sidebar. It will search the posts for words or phrases, and will highlight the words or phrases in the posts that match
  • Beefed up my headers (stuff you can’t see that’s sent with the http request)
  • Small formatting changes
